Third time the charm for Afleet Doll?

Ron Gierkink|Sep 14, 2016
Click Here for video

ETOBICOKE, Ontario – The weekend Woodbine cards, most notably the Woodbine Mile program Saturday, are loaded, which has left Friday’s nine-race card without a turf or allowance event.

There are some promising 2-year-old fillies in the fifth race, a maiden special weight sprint, including third-time starter Afleet Doll. She was a close second going five furlongs in her debut behind Just Be Kind, who subsequently captured the Ontario Debutante Stakes with a 75 Beyer Speed Figure.

With blinkers on, Afleet Doll was bet down to 7-5 in another five-furlong maiden special most recently Sept. 3. After racing in third on the turn, she made up some ground to finish second behind a sharp Keep Your Head Up.

On Friday, trainer Mike Wright is taking the blinkers off Afleet Doll, which could be to her benefit as she lengthens out to six furlongs.

KEY CONTENDERS

Afleet Doll, by Afleet Alex

Beyers: 50-68

◗ Woodbine’s hottest rider, Rafael Hernandez, picks up the mount. He has a win and three seconds when teaming up with Wright.

Lovemelikeyoudo, by Harlan’s Holiday

◗ The first-time starter is by a deceased sire who has gotten a good 14 percent 2-year-old debut winners. The stakes-winning dam hasn’t produced anything of note.

DRF Formulator fact: During the past five years, trainer Mark Casse has a 21 percent success rate with 2-year-old maiden special debuters on synthetics, with a return on investment of $1.60.

Malibu Bliss, by Malibu Moon

Beyers: 40-27

◗ This Casse trainee was beaten in double digits in both of her outings, but her last race, which came on the grass at Saratoga, contained three next-out winners. Her Sunday work here on the Tapeta, five-eighths in 59.80 seconds, was among the quickest of the day.

Maritimeconnection, by Lookin At Lucky

◗ Her sire has yielded 14 percent first-out juvenile winners, and the stakes-winning dam dropped Grade 2 stakes winner Passion for Action and stakes-placed Maritime Pulpit.

Lemon Zip, by Ghostzapper

Beyer: 45

◗ After missing the break, she mounted a belated wide bid to finish a distant third at first asking in a six-furlong maiden special Aug. 13. Victorious Ghostly Presence returned to finish fifth in the Ontario Debutante.

Leighlin Road, by Midnight Lute

Beyer: 46

◗ She raced wide throughout, closing from sixth to end up third in her only start, which came in a six-furlong contest for $50,000 maidens.

Matching Vows, by Broken Vow

◗ Her sire has gotten 10 percent 2-year-old debut winners, and her dam dropped the versatile stakes winner Double Malt.
